Runbook 4.2 — Uniform delivery, Harlow Fen Depot. The first tranche of Vexbridge Workwear uniforms for the new Harlow Fen depot arrives Thursday on the morning shuttle. Dispatch is to stage the cartons in Bay 3, grouped by size band, and log the carton count against the Vexbridge packing note. Do not break seals; sizing disputes go back to procurement. The courier collecting the surplus sizing samples must be briefed as follows before release.

dispatch memo: the lamwyn fenwyn courier leaves the wenir ledger at gate 7175 under passcode 822969

### Step 4: Backfill the shadow table

Before flipping traffic on Quillhaven's orders service, backfill `orders_v2` while the old table stays writable. Run the backfill in batches of 500 with a 200ms pause to avoid lock contention, and verify row counts match before proceeding to Step 5. Never run this against production directly; use the migration replica. The backfill script reads its target from the connection string below.

primary connection of yagep-kahip = redis://giliel_svc:zYiKsLL2PLpfPL@db-348f.xolmarsys.corp:5432/fenwyn

Subject: DR drill results — Cindersweep orphaned-resource sweeper. Team, Thursday's disaster-recovery drill at Galeport exercised a full failover of Cindersweep, the service that reclaims orphaned volumes and dangling load balancers. Failover completed in eleven minutes; the sweeper resumed with no duplicate deletions. One gap: the standby region's vault required manual recovery before Cindersweep could authenticate. For the record, and for next quarter's drill, the recovery passphrase used is noted below.

unlock words, yagag-yahog: gordor-zorvan-druius-queniel-normir-norwyn-framir-novmir-ralius-holwyn-wenwyn-tamael-silok-holdor